Parsing for Targeted Errors in Controlled Languages

The use of Controlled Languages in technical documentation is becoming a large concern for many organisations. Authoring texts which conform to these speciications is a problematic process: the language deenition may be vague, the most immediate grammatical construction may not be permitted and so on. Technological support for the writing process may ooer a number of aids, including style, or grammar, checkers. The ability to recognise variations to the prescribed grammar is at the heart of such systems. This paper presents a variation on the chart parsing method which encodes the grammar as nite state automata productions instead of a linear description of constituents. The system allows the grammar writer to deene a number of variations to a grammar rule, in the form of targeted insertions and deletions, which are represented as transformations to the automata.
